Boiled Chicken Breast Slices

The recipe for boiled chicken slices is practical and light. Thanks to this cooking method, no additional fats are added to the meat, which remains lean and rich in protein. It is an ideal dish to eat even for those who are watching their weight.
To prepare the dish, you can use AIA's Thin Slices, already sliced. Alternatively, you can start with AIA's chicken breast). At the end of cooking, the meat will then be cut into horizontal slices.
The recipe for boiled chicken breast slices allows you to prepare two dishes in one. Once the meat is drained, you can reuse the broth to make soups and first courses like tortellini in broth.
Procedure
In a pot, boil a scraped and chopped carrot, a peeled and halved onion, and two chopped celery stalks in water.
When the water boils, add the salt, pepper, and chicken breast slices. Cook until the meat is cooked and turns white.
Drain the boiled chicken breast slices and set them aside. Let them cool for a few minutes.
Serve the boiled chicken breast slices with a drizzle of oil and lemon juice.

Suggestions
To know if the chicken breast slices are cooked, you can stick a fork in the thickest part of the meat. If it goes in without resistance, it's ready.
